Victoria Orenze’s New Single “Too Oiled” Inspires Believers with a Profound Message

Gospel music aficionada Victoria Orenze returns to the spiritual stage with the inspiring anthem “Too Oiled.” This fresh release transcends a mere song; it’s a heartfelt declaration that strikes a chord within the heart of every believer. With divine confidence and a compelling message, Orenze adeptly reminds us of the abundant anointing granted to us by God.

Embracing the Anointing: A Scriptural Foundation

At the core of “Too Oiled” is a powerful inspiration drawn from Psalm 23:5. The verse elegantly conveys God’s promise: “You prepare a table before me in the presence of my enemies; you anoint my head with oil; my cup overflows.” Orenze embraces this scripture, seamlessly integrating it into a melody that serves to remind us of the protection and blessings that accompany God’s anointed.

“With ‘Too Oiled,’ I aim to convey that we are God’s chosen,” expresses Victoria. This message is not solely for the choir; it resonates with every listener who has faced insecurity or been overwhelmed. The lesson is straightforward yet profound: the endless grace and favor of God are open to all who believe.

A Call to Divine Identity and Purpose

“Too Oiled” transcends being just a song; it acts as a powerful reminder to acknowledge one’s divine identity and purpose. Orenze delivers a potent affirmation: “You are too oiled. You’re anointed. The Spirit of the Lord is upon you, and the oil is flowing over you.” This proclamation aims to spiritually awaken listeners, empowering them to fully embrace their roles as God’s chosen individuals.

The lively enthusiasm woven into the lyrics inspires people to transition from passive listening to active participation. Orenze prompts her audience to embody the message during live performances, inviting them to “lay your hands on your head as you sing.” This personal involvement turns the act of worship into a hands-on experience, fostering a connection with the divine through faith and engagement.
